Shop local on the high street

Us Brits always seem to be moaning that it’s difficult to shop on the local high street, but you truly can in Tooting! Tooting Market is full of life during the day but has a renewed zest at night when the bars and restaurants open up. There’s a whole host of independent shops and brands to choose from, so you can pick up a great range of genuine British produce.

Put your Bake Off skills to the test at The Castle pub

The Castle pub is not your usual Brit boozer – there’s a whole Bake Off-style tent in the car park! The tent hosts baking contests year-round so fans of the show can test out their skills and see how well they’d fare on the show.

Score the best Asian food in London on the Curry Mile

The Tooting Curry Mile is home to some stunning Asian restaurants and is far less full of tourists than the more commercial Brick Lane neighbourhood. Running between Tooting Bec and Tooting Broadway, you can choose from traditional Indian, Pakistani, Sri Lankan and Gujurati food… or visit the supermarkets and take home the ingredients to experiment at making your own!
